/* X2

html { background: fixed url('/media/images/site-bg-bg.png') repeat-x bottom center; }
body { background: fixed url('/media/images/site-bg.png') no-repeat bottom center; }
 */

/* HEADERS */
#content h1 { color: #7eb001; }
#content h2 { color: #719F00; }
#content h3 { color: #666666; }
#content h4 { color: #88c100; }

/* LINKS */
#content a:hover, #container ol.process li a:hover, #container ol.process li a:hover 
{ border-bottom: 2px solid #7eb001; color: #222; }

/* SIDEBAR */
#sidebar h4, #sidebar h4 a { color: #7eb001 !important; }

#subpages ul li.current_page_item a {
	background-color: #7eb001;
	color: #ffffff !important;
}

#subpages ul li.current_page_item ul li a {
	background-color: #f9f9f9;
	color: #a0a0a0 !important;
}

#subpages ul li a:hover, #subpages ul li ul li a:hover {
	background-color: #719F00;
	color: #ffffff !important;
}


/* TABLES */
.packages td.highlight { color: #669900; }
.packages td.highlight, #packages th.highlight {
font-size: 14px;
padding:3px 7px 2px 7px;
}
.packages th.highlight {
background: #9AC500;
background: -webkit-gradient(linear, left top, left bottom, from(#7DAF01), to(#9AC500));
background: -moz-linear-gradient(top, #7DAF01, #9AC500);
color: #fff;
filter:  progid:DXImageTransform.Microsoft.gradient(startColorstr='#7DAF01', endColorstr='#9AC500');
font-size: 35px;
padding-top: 5px;
padding-bottom: 10px;
text-align: center;
text-shadow:1px 1px 3px #5E8904 !important;
text-transform: uppercase;
width: 40%;
}

.packages th.highlight small { font-size: 15px; }

.packages td.arrow.highlight { background: url('/media/images/package-arrow-logo.png') no-repeat top center; }

.packages tr.cost td.highlight {
color:#88C100;
font-size: 55px;
font-weight: bold;
letter-spacing: -5px;
text-align: center;
padding-right:35px;
text-shadow: 1px 1px 2px #888888;
}

.packages tr.alt td.highlight { background-color:#E6EFD1 !important; }

.packages tr.buy td.highlight {
font-weight: bold;
text-align: center;
}

/* CONTACT */

input.textsubmit, input.textsubmit:link, input.textsubmit:active {
background-color:#88C100;
border: none;
color: #FFFFFF !important;
display: block !important;
float: right;
font-family: arial;
font-size: 30px;
font-weight: bold !important;
height: 50px;
margin: 15px 0;
outline: none none !important;
padding: 8px;
text-align: center;
text-transform: uppercase;
}

input.textsubmit:hover {
background-color:#669900;
color:#FFFFFF !important;
cursor: pointer;
}

textarea:focus, input:focus {
      background-color: #F5FBEE;
}

option {
background-color:#88C100;
border:1px solid #88C100;
color:#FFFFFF;
padding: 0 10px 3px;
}

.contact-right input, .contact-left input {
border: 1px solid #88C100 !important;
border-left: 4px;
}

.contact-right select, .contact-left select {
border: 1px solid #88C100 !important;
}
.contact-right textarea, .contact-left textarea {
border: 1px solid #88C100 !important;
}

/* PROCESS */

#container ol.process li {
background: url('/media/images/process-bullet-logo.png') no-repeat 5px 5px;
}

/* SLIDER

#slider li {
	height: 200px;
	overflow: hidden;
	width: 400px;
}

ol#controls li.current a{
	background: #E2EFC2;
	border: 1px solid #CAE38D;
	color: #669900;
	}

 */

/* GALLERY start */

div#gallery a:hover img { background-color: #88C100; border: 1px solid #88C100; }

div#gallery h4, div#gallery h4 a { color: #88C100; }
div#gallery h4 a:hover { color: #639102; }

#lbOverlay { background-color: #364F00 !important; }
#lbCaption { color: #88C100; padding:7px 5px 7px 15px; }

/* GALLERY end */


/* BUTTON start */

.button, .button:visited {
	border: solid 1px #7DAF01;
	background: #9AC500;
	background: -webkit-gradient(linear, left top, left bottom, from(#9AC500), to(#7DAF01));
	background: -moz-linear-gradient(top, #9AC500, #7DAF01);
	filter:  progid:DXImageTransform.Microsoft.gradient(startColorstr='#9AC500', endColorstr='#7DAF01');
}
.button:hover {
	background: #7DAF01;
	background: -webkit-gradient(linear, left top, left bottom, from(#7DAF01), to(#669900));
	background: -moz-linear-gradient(top,  #7DAF01,  #669900);
	filter:  progid:DXImageTransform.Microsoft.gradient(startColorstr='#7DAF01', endColorstr='#669900');
}
.button:active {
        background: -webkit-gradient(linear, left top, left bottom, from(#669900), to(#669900));
	background: -moz-linear-gradient(top,  #669900,  #669900);
	filter:  progid:DXImageTransform.Microsoft.gradient(startColorstr='#669900', endColorstr='#669900');
}


/*BUTTON end */


/* END X2 END */
